Introduction to Car Key Locksmiths
A car key locksmith is a specialist who specializes in managing concerns associated with vehicle locks and keys. These professionals can produce new keys, replace lost or broken keys, and even program advanced key fobs and transponder keys. When confronted with a lockout or key-related problem, a locksmith can provide timely and reliable services, ensuring that you return on the road with minimal hassle.
When You Might Need a Car Key Locksmith
There are a number of situations where you may find yourself in need of a car key locksmith:
- Locked Out of Your Car: This is among the most common circumstances. You might accidentally lock your keys inside the vehicle or find that your key fob has actually stopped working.
- Lost or Stolen Keys: Losing your car keys can be a considerable trouble, and if they are stolen, it can be a security danger.
- Broken Keys: Keys can break due to wear and tear, especially if they are old or have been dropped.
- Key Programming: Many contemporary cars and trucks require key programming, which includes syncing the key with the vehicle's internal security system. This is needed for keys with sophisticated functions like remote start or keyless entry.
- Transponder Key Issues: Transponder keys include a microchip that communicates with the car's immobilizer system. If this chip stops working, you might require a locksmith to reprogram or replace it.

Frequently Asked Questions About Car Key Locksmiths
Q: How much does it cost to get a brand-new car key from a locksmith?A: The cost can differ depending upon the type of key and the intricacy of the task. For a basic key, the cost might vary from ₤ 20 to ₤ 50. Advanced keys, such as those with transponders or keyless entry, can cost in between ₤ 50 and ₤ 200.
Q: Can a locksmith make a key without the initial?A: Yes, an expert locksmith can develop a brand-new key even if you do not have the original. They might need the vehicle's VIN number or other determining information to guarantee the brand-new key is a perfect match.
Q: How long does it take for a locksmith to arrive?A: Most locksmith professionals aim to arrive within an hour, but this can vary depending upon your location and the locksmith's current work. Some locksmith professionals provide 24/7 emergency services for immediate situations.
Q: Are car key locksmith professionals readily available on weekends and holidays?A: Many locksmith professionals use weekend and vacation services, particularly those who supply 24/7 emergency situation assistance. However, it's a good idea to check the locksmith's accessibility beforehand.
Q: Is it legal for a locksmith to make a new key?A: Yes, it is legal for a locksmith to make a brand-new key, provided they have the correct authorization. They may request evidence of ownership or other recognizing files to guarantee they are not producing a key for unapproved usage.
Q: Can a locksmith reset my car's immobilizer system?A: Yes, a locksmith can reset your car's immobilizer system, especially if the problem is related to a malfunctioning key fob or transponder. They will have the required equipment and competence to perform this job.
